The cheapest way to get from Lausanne to Cessy is to rideshare which costs €3 and takes 58 min.
The fastest way to get from Lausanne to Cessy is to drive which takes 44 min and costs €10 - €15.
No, there is no direct bus from Lausanne station to Cessy. However, there are services departing from Lausanne Bus Station and arriving at Cessy, Saint-Denis via Genève, gare Cornavin.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 50m.
The distance between Lausanne and Cessy is 75 km. The road distance is 57.3 km.
The best way to get from Lausanne to Cessy without a car is to train and line 60 bus which takes 1h 39m and costs €28 - €85.
It takes approximately 1h 39m to get from Lausanne to Cessy, including transfers.
